Output cd44345e4dba445cb3f3dcff80e850dfd55a38d0097dd518634b5ebecb08522d:0

value
17362233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b5fccb4c0de7fabeab1bf8c5a8e71125d72bde OP_EQUAL
address
34mGEavgkb1xZhZVqJLjwPpFf9T83g7hV4
transaction
cd44345e4dba445cb3f3dcff80e850dfd55a38d0097dd518634b5ebecb08522d
confirmations
367014
spent
true